Car -TDCi Figo.
3 rd gear above 1800 rpm is like fun. No other gear matches this fun, the car just takes off. That's my sweetest spot
Same here. The TDCi in Figo develops it's peak torque @ 2000 rpm (according to the specification sheet) and you can feel it too. You can feel the eagerness of the engine when the tacho needle crosses over the 2000 rpm marker. 2nd and 3rd gear and the rpm hovering over the 2000 mark is the sweet spot for me.
For the Santro, there is no tacho and I have to rely on the music from the engine. (Peak torque of 9.8Kgm @ 3000 rpm) So, it should be around 3000 I guess.

Swift Diesel -

Sedate City Driving - Anything Below 2000 rpm and a light accelerator, she ll respond with a mild speed increase. Perfect for city Driving

Highway Drives - 3rd gear is a murder weapon and will make the car reach 90 kmph in a jiffy after which 4th and 5th take over the pull till 150 after which things slow down a bit.

Sweet Spot for fun driving 2000 to around 3500 after which its pointless.

80 kmph comes in 5th gear at 2000 rpm so for highway drives its best to maintain 80 + for being in the meat of the powerband.
